For LG’s newest MCV904, a sound system which is able to remove the vocals from any music allowing the user to sing as if in a karaoke bar. In several music-stores LG and its agency Young & Rubicam, placed little mirrors on every CD-cover. Next to the mirror a little stickers with “Now you can be the lead singer of this band” was placed.

Ever seen a man go so far for his business. This man is an owner of an electronics store in STockholm. To fight its big competitors he decided to do something crazy and win him some free press. He swallowed a custom-made wireless soundsystem and then broadcasted the music. People could even request a song over the internet.
Crazy stunt, but it worked..
